Most Wanted Monday: International Songwriting Competition artists notified of SX royalties

November 22nd

SoundExchange frequently does matching exercises with partner organizations, by which we match our list of artists owed royalties to a partner’s list of artist contact information. You may have received one or more emails from our partner organizations informing you of money waiting for you at SoundExchange. Do not ignore these emails – they are a golden ticket to digital performance royalties!

Forbes names SoundExchange among “Names You Need to Know in 2011″

November 8th

Forbes has nominated Soundexchange to be among the top “Names You Need to Know in 2011.” With revenues across the music industry continuing to slide, SoundExchange is ramping up distributions to recording artists and copyright holders, and hoping to send out millions more. We’re not going to come right out and say SoundExchange is future of the industry….but Forbes did.
